detoxify

Pronunciation: /diːˈtɒksɪfʌɪ/
Translate detoxify | into German | into Italian
Definition of detoxify

verb (detoxifies, detoxifying, detoxified)

[with object]
  • remove toxic substances from:the process uses chemical reagents to detoxify the oil
  • abstain or help to abstain from drink and drugs until the bloodstream is free of toxins, in order to overcome alcoholism or drug addiction: [no object]:if they are not able to detoxify in their normal environment then they will never come off drugs [with object]:he was twice detoxified from heroin
  • [no object] become free of harmful substances:you can help your body detoxify by cutting down on coffee

Derivatives

detoxifier

noun

Origin:

early 20th century: from de- (expressing removal) + Latin toxicum 'poison' + -fy
